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ll assess the damage, identify the source of the water, and create a customized plan to tackle the job. Our technicians are trained to spot potential issues that could lead to further problems down the line.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to remove as much water as possible from the affected area. Our team is trained to work efficiently, but also carefully, to avoid causing further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ry the area, including air movers and dehumidifiers. This step is crucial to preventing mold growth and further damage.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ize the area to prevent the growth of bacteria, mold, and mildew. Our team uses eco-friendly cleaning products whenever possible.
Step 5: Reconstruction and Repair
Once the area is dry and clean, our team will work with you to rebuild and repair any damaged structures, flooring, or walls.

Warning Signs You Need Bedroom Water Removal
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Don’t wait until it’s too late, be aware of these common signs of water damage in your Bedroom: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ors can show mold growth or standing water.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to serious health issues and costly repairs.
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ls
Water stains can be a sign of a leak or burst pipe. Don’t delay, these stains can spread and cause further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or uneven drying. Our team can assess the damage and provide a plan to restore your floors to their original condition.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. Don’t wait, our team can help you restore your walls to their original condition.
Unusual Noises or Sounds
Unusual noises or sounds can show water flowing through your walls or ceilings.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ards.
Visible Water Leaks
Visible water leaks can be a sign of a burst pipe or appliance issue. Don’t delay, our team can help you identify and fix the problem quickly and efficiently.
Bedroom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 1 inch deep) | Yes | No | DIY cleanup is usually safe and effective for small spills. |
| Burst pipe or appliance leak |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
| Standing water (over 2 inches deep) | No | Yes | Standing water need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ely and effectively. |
| Visible mold growth | No | Yes | Mold growth needs professional cleanup and remediation to prevent health hazards. |
| Water damage to structural elements (e.g., walls, floors) | No | Yes | Water damage to structural elements needs professional assessment and repair to ensure safety and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age to sensitive electronics or appliances | No | Yes | Water damage to sensitive electronics or appliances needs specialized cleaning and repair to prevent further damage or failure. |

Bedroom Water Removal Cost in Perth Amboy, NJ
The cost of Bedroom Water Removal can vary greatly dep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Perth Amboy, NJ. Our team will provide a free estimate and transparent pricing so you know exactly what to expect.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$300 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products needed |
| Reconstruction and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of repairs needed |
| Insurance Claims Help | Free (included with service) | Insurance company requirements, complexity of claims process |
